Review on river bank filtration as an in-situ water treatment process.
Surface and ground water are valuable sources for drinking water. Certain industrial, mining, and agricultural practices pollute these critical resources. Riverbank filtration (RBF) is a cost effective in-situ water treatment process, which removes suspended solids, organic and inorganic pollutants.
